Movies Logo
Season 1
December 27, 2024

Season 1

01. Episode 1

Logan arrives in a strange coastal town.

December 27, 2024

02. Episode 2

As Logan continue to search the strange town and gather supplies, he observes several Inhabitants acting in bizarre ways.

January 3, 2025

03. Episode 3

Logan discovers a large group of Inhabitants and attempts to capture one of them.

January 10, 2025

04. Episode 4

Relatively safe on the coastline, Logan plans his next steps.

January 18, 2025

05. Episode 5

No longer able to stay hidden, Logan is forced to confront The Inhabitants.

January 24, 2025

06. Episode 6

As Logan continues to explore the strange town he comes face to face with Isaac, who presents him with an offer.

February 7, 2025

07. Episode 7

Unable to escape to the safety of his boat, Logan is pursued through through the woods by The Inhabitants.

March 7, 2025

08. Episode 8

You would think Logan would be excited to find any other human surviving in town... but once you meet Pat, you'll wonder if he was better off on his own.

11min
March 28, 2025

09. Episode 9

Logan has come a long way since the day this all began... but the Inhabitants have been learning, and their next move might seal his fate on the island forever.

6min
April 20, 2025